/*
 * This file contains all of the OS-dependent stuff:
 *   startup, signals, BSD sockets for tcp/ip, i/o, timing.
 *
 * The data flow for input is:
 *    Game_loop ---> Read_from_descriptor ---> Read
 *    Game_loop ---> Read_from_buffer
 *
 * The data flow for output is:
 *    Game_loop ---> Process_Output ---> Write_to_descriptor -> Write
 *
 * The OS-dependent functions are Read_from_descriptor and Write_to_descriptor.
 * -- Furey  26 Jan 1993
 */

#if defined(unix)
void game_loop_unix( int control )
{
    static struct timeval null_time;
    struct timeval last_time;

    signal( SIGPIPE, SIG_IGN );
    gettimeofday( &last_time, NULL );
    current_time = (time_t) last_time.tv_sec;

    /* Main loop */
    while ( !merc_down )
    {
	fd_set in_set;
	fd_set out_set;
	fd_set exc_set;
	DESCRIPTOR_DATA *d;
	int maxdesc;

#if defined(MALLOC_DEBUG)
	if ( malloc_verify( ) != 1 )
	    abort( );
#endif

	/*
	 * Poll all active descriptors.
	 */
	FD_ZERO( &in_set  );
	FD_ZERO( &out_set );
	FD_ZERO( &exc_set );
	FD_SET( control, &in_set );
	maxdesc	= control;
	for ( d = descriptor_list; d; d = d->next )
	{
	    maxdesc = UMAX( maxdesc, d->descriptor );
	    FD_SET( d->descriptor, &in_set  );
	    FD_SET( d->descriptor, &out_set );
	    FD_SET( d->descriptor, &exc_set );
	}

	if ( select( maxdesc+1, &in_set, &out_set, &exc_set, &null_time ) < 0 )
	{
	    perror( "Game_loop: select: poll" );
	    exit( 1 );
	}

	/*
	 * New connection?
	 */
	if ( FD_ISSET( control, &in_set ) )
	    new_descriptor( control );

	/*
	 * Kick out the freaky folks.
	 */
	for ( d = descriptor_list; d != NULL; d = d_next )
	{
	    d_next = d->next;   
	    if ( FD_ISSET( d->descriptor, &exc_set ) )
	    {
		FD_CLR( d->descriptor, &in_set  );
		FD_CLR( d->descriptor, &out_set );
		if ( d->character )
		    save_char_obj( d->character );
		d->outtop	= 0;
		close_socket( d );
	    }
	}

	/*
	 * Process input.
	 */
	for ( d = descriptor_list; d != NULL; d = d_next )
	{
	    d_next	= d->next;
	    d->fcommand	= FALSE;

	    if ( FD_ISSET( d->descriptor, &in_set ) )
	    {
		if ( d->character != NULL )
		    d->character->timer = 0;
		if ( !read_from_descriptor( d ) )
		{
		    FD_CLR( d->descriptor, &out_set );
		    if ( d->character != NULL )
			save_char_obj( d->character );
		    d->outtop	= 0;
		    close_socket( d );
		    continue;
		}
	    }

	    if ( d->character != NULL && d->character->wait > 0 )
	    {
		--d->character->wait;
		continue;
	    }

	    read_from_buffer( d );
	    if ( d->incomm[0] != '\0' )
	    {
		d->fcommand	= TRUE;
		stop_idling( d->character );

		/* OLC */
		if ( d->showstr_point )
		    show_string( d, d->incomm );
		else if ( d->pString )
		    string_add( d->character, d->incomm );
		else if ( d->connected == CON_PLAYING )
		{
		    if ( !run_olc_editor( d ) )
			interpret( d->character, d->incomm );
		}
		else
		{
	 	    nanny( d, d->incomm );
		}
		d->incomm[0]	= '\0';

		/* removed for OLC
		if ( d->connected == CON_PLAYING )
		{
		    if ( d->showstr_point )
		        show_string( d, d->incomm );
		    else
		        interpret( d->character, d->incomm );
		}
		else
		    nanny( d, d->incomm );

		d->incomm[0]	= '\0';
		*/
	    }
	}



	/*
	 * Autonomous game motion.
	 */
	update_handler( );



	/*
	 * Output.
	 */
	for ( d = descriptor_list; d != NULL; d = d_next )
	{
	    d_next = d->next;

	    if ( ( d->fcommand || d->outtop > 0 )
	    &&   FD_ISSET(d->descriptor, &out_set) )
	    {
		if ( !process_output( d, TRUE ) )
		{
		    if ( d->character != NULL )
			save_char_obj( d->character );
		    d->outtop	= 0;
		    close_socket( d );
		}
	    }
	}



	/*
	 * Synchronize to a clock.
	 * Sleep( last_time + 1/PULSE_PER_SECOND - now ).
	 * Careful here of signed versus unsigned arithmetic.
	 */
	{
	    struct timeval now_time;
	    long secDelta;
	    long usecDelta;

	    gettimeofday( &now_time, NULL );
	    usecDelta	= ((int) last_time.tv_usec) - ((int) now_time.tv_usec)
			+ 1000000 / PULSE_PER_SECOND;
	    secDelta	= ((int) last_time.tv_sec ) - ((int) now_time.tv_sec );
	    while ( usecDelta < 0 )
	    {
		usecDelta += 1000000;
		secDelta  -= 1;
	    }

	    while ( usecDelta >= 1000000 )
	    {
		usecDelta -= 1000000;
		secDelta  += 1;
	    }

	    if ( secDelta > 0 || ( secDelta == 0 && usecDelta > 0 ) )
	    {
		struct timeval stall_time;

		stall_time.tv_usec = usecDelta;
		stall_time.tv_sec  = secDelta;
		if ( select( 0, NULL, NULL, NULL, &stall_time ) < 0 )
		{
		    perror( "Game_loop: select: stall" );
		    exit( 1 );
		}
	    }
	}

	gettimeofday( &last_time, NULL );
	current_time = (time_t) last_time.tv_sec;
    }

    return;
}
#endif
